Runbook: GiveSlip Receipt Mailer

Scope: failed or delayed donation receipts.

1. Check the mailer queue in the Lanternhall console. Stuck jobs older than 30 min: requeue.
2. Bounced addresses: mark donor record, do not retry.
3. Template errors: escalate to the Birchline team, do not edit templates yourself.
4. If the mailer rejects all jobs with auth errors, the service credential has lapsed. Re-authenticate against the internal receipt service before retrying. Use the key below for manual calls.

gateway credential: zpat15_lMLOSdhT94y0U3l

# Data Stores: Wrenloft Realtime Service

So, the websocket reconnect bug. When clients drop and reconnect within 5 seconds, the session table in our presence database keeps the stale row, and the new socket gets ghosted. The fix (shipped in 4.2) upserts on reconnect instead of inserting, but if you ever see duplicate presence rows again, check the cleanup job first — it runs hourly. The presence database is the small one, not the event log. Connect to it with this string.

replica DSN, kajep-yahag: mssql://praok_svc:iF@db-8d68.plorvaio.local:5432/eliion

## 2.14.0 — Signing key rotation

The key used to sign Driftgate's zero-downtime migration bundles was rotated following the quarterly policy at Hollow Creek. Migrations continue to apply in the usual expand-then-contract sequence, so no schema behavior changes. If you run migrations locally, replace the old key in your verifier config before applying anything new. The current signing key is listed below.

rollout seal: bky4_DFM9

Ticket WK-2241: Role inheritance leak in Fernwiki spaces

Summary: Users granted "commenter" on a parent space in Fernwiki can edit pages in child spaces when the child has no explicit ACL. The resolver falls back to the parent's broadest role instead of the narrowest, violating our least-privilege policy. Repro steps attached; affects all tenants on the shared cluster. No evidence of exploitation in audit logs so far. Reproduced against the build noted directly below.

pipeline stamp: htk9_ce63042d9